Numerology assists clarify and tends to make sense of the universe and how you match into it, at least according to its proponents. It is an ancient practice drawing from many ancient cultures, such as the Egyptians, the Ancient Greeks via famed mathematician and philosopher Pythagoras, The Chaldeans and Babylonians, The Hebrew Kabbalah, early Gnosticism, and The Hindu Vedas, possibly the oldest sacred texts in existence.

There are several variants of Numerology, including Modern (also known as Pythagorean), Chaldean, and Indian and all consider one's name to be very essential. We will particularly discuss Modern Numerology in this article and the effects of your name.

Numerology derives a number of easy numbers from various elements of yourself, including a Life Path Number from your date of birth and Destiny and Expression Numbers from your name. Your Destiny quantity explains strengths and weaknesses, which may or may not be realized, and your Soul Urge quantity reveals inner desires, the genuine "inner you."

A reasonable query to ask is which name? Many people have numerous names, including their birth name, nicknames which may alter all through life, possibly a different married name. And another query relates to a purposeful name change, for instance a stage name or pen name. These questions all have simple answers!

Your most important name is your name at time of birth. This is the name your parents chose for you, and Numerologists think that absolutely nothing is random, you had been offered your birth name simply because it was the perfect name for you.

Your Destiny and Soul Urge, and other numbers that rely on your name need to be calculated from your birth name. The only exception is babies that had been adopted very young, before they knew their names. In this case, the adopted name is utilized. Nicknames and married names do have some effect, but it is fairly insignificant compared to the effect of your birth name.

What about other name changes, for example a stage name for an actor or an immigrant that modifications their name to a much less "ethnic" name or a name change to a name that is considered Numerologically superior by the name changee? There is some debate and various opinions in the Numerological community, so you may get other opinions as well, but if a name change is component of your natural group as a human it has a significant impact, otherwise it has no significant effect.
